Font Size: a A A

Design And Development Of College Foreign Language Network Examination System

Posted on:2019-01-19Degree:MasterType:Thesis
Country:ChinaCandidate:J FengFull Text:PDF
GTID:2428330566970974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Network examination refers to the network information platform based on the database of test questions with processed,so as to realize the paperless,information and automation of the whole process of the College English test,including basic information management,curriculum management,database management,automatic scoring,with the basic functions of user information management.Traditional college foreign language tests need to be done in advance,such as manual examination,examination paper printing,examination organization,teacher marking,assessment analysis,test paper filing and so on.The networked examination platform can control all the testing processes through information technology and link all links in the college foreign language testing,and provide a solid data foundation for further exploring and exploring the reform of foreign language teaching and teaching reform.Aiming at the actual use of college foreign languages,this paper designs and implements a web based university foreign language testing system,which should be able to help university teachers establish a complete test bank.The author carefully read all kinds of documents,initially grasp the characteristics and various technologies of the networked examination platform,and communicate with the foreign language colleges of the cooperative colleges and universities,grasp the business characteristics of the college foreign language test and analyze the needs of them.Then demand analysis with the results of foreign teachers repeated communication,to determine the system model based on the demand of the design of the system function module,system architecture,database information.In order to solve the problem of the safety and non repudiation of examination papers,we use symmetric cryptography and public key cryptography to solve the two problems of examination paper's confidentiality and non tampering.When the test paper is released,the server generates random symmetric key,and encrypts the examination information with symmetric key,then encrypts the symmetric key with the public key of the teacher machine,then sends it to the teacher machine.The teacher's machine decrypts it with his own private key,and gets the symmetric key of the session.When the exam is ready,the teacher calls the symmetric key to decrypt and sends out the papers to the student side.Through cooperation with colleges and universities,two tests have been carried out on the developed system,which strongly proves that the system can well support the test of the university foreign language.
Keywords/Search Tags:College Foreign Language, Network Exam, Requirement Analysis, Information Security
PDF Full Text Request
Related items